Owner report 10128679 · 2005-07-13 (July 13, 2005)
PONTIAC TRANSPORT MONTANA WAS PARKED IN A PARKING LOT FOR 1/2 HOUR OR SO AND BECAME INGULFED IN FLAMES. FIRE MARSHALL THINKS IT WAS FROM BATTERY/ ELECTRIC. DESTROYED OUR CAR AND 5 OTHERS. NO HUMANS HURT...THANK GOD IT WAS PARKED AND MY SON WAS NOT DRIVING IT.
Owner-reported narrative. 100,000 miles reported. Look up ODI 10128679 at NHTSA ↗
Owner report 10051512 · 2004-01-02 (January 2, 2004)
THE MOST IMPORTANT PROBLEM THAT I HAVE HAD WITH THIS CAR IS THAT WHEN MAKING RIGHT HAND TURNS, GOING APPROX 5-10 MILES AN HOUR, THE CAR WILL SHUT ITSELF OFF COMPLETELY. IN ORDER TO RETURN DRIVING, THE CAR MUST BE PUT INTO PARK AND THEN RESTARTED. THIS HAS OCCURRED MANY TIMES. THE CAR HAS BEEN TAKEN TO SEVERAL DIFFERENT PROFESSIONALS AND NO ONE HAS AN EXPLANATION.
